What is the ruling on purchasing gold from the central bank online if it involves paying fees and a percentage of the gold, while the buyer does not receive a certificate of ownership in case of unavailability?
When purchasing gold with money, immediate possession is required, either hand-to-hand or by depositing the gold into a special account belonging to the buyer immediately upon payment in the same session. Otherwise, it would be forbidden Riba (usury). It is a condition that the account be specific to the buyer, such that he can withdraw the gold from it at any time. The evidence for this is the Prophet, peace and blessings be upon him, who said: "Gold for gold... hand to hand." Currencies take the rulings of gold and silver. There is no harm in paying fees or taxes on stored gold, but the full price of the gold must be paid, and it must genuinely be owned and deposited immediately into the buyer's account.
